If you’re in need of computer vision development services, you’ve come to the right place. Computer vision has the potential to solve many of the world’s problems, including multi-lingual speech recognition and rules-based decision engines.
Hiring an expert team to develop your computer vision application can be an arduous task, but an experienced partner will be able to provide you with a clear strategy and mitigate your risks. Computer vision is one of the most exciting markets on the planet, and it requires a significant amount of time, money, and expertise to execute. To get the most out of your computer vision investment, you need to know the right tech stack and strategy.
With the advancement of artificial intelligence and machine learning, computer vision technology has become a popular and highly effective tool for a variety of applications. Automated AI vision inspection and remote monitoring, for example, have made computer vision a highly beneficial technology for many industries. Companies in all industries can use computer vision to improve their processes and save lives. It is even becoming an essential part of your business, allowing you to analyze videos without any human help.
In traditional agriculture, yield and quality of crops play a vital role in food security. While manual labor and human judgment are still the mainstays of agricultural practices, computer vision technologies are making this process more accurate and efficient. With real-time crop monitoring, farmers can identify subtle changes in crops, allowing them to react to changing conditions more quickly and efficiently. The ability to predict sugarcane yields using images obtained from UAVs is a major benefit of computer vision technology.
Computer vision engineers work closely with other personnel outside of the field of computer science. These engineers apply their extensive knowledge of algorithms and statistics to solving real-world problems. They are skilled at developing computer vision models and implement novel embedded architectures. They must be skilled in at least one programming language, and have intermediate-level knowledge of another. Besides being proficient in Python and C++, computer vision engineers must be experienced in various languages, including Python, Java, and Java.
There are many real-world uses for computer vision in agriculture. Computer vision technology has helped farmers to monitor their crops from the air, providing them with information that may not be visible from the ground. UAVs equipped with cameras can take pictures of crops and transmit them back to a central base station at a rate of up to 30 frames per second. The images are then analyzed by computer vision algorithms that look for anomalies in the crop such as dead spots or disease. These algorithms can be trained to recognize these anomalies and alert farmers when they occur.
Computer vision technologies are also being used to monitor cattle on large farms. Cattle are often tagged with RFID tags or ear tags that contain information about the animal’s breed, sex, location and other characteristics that could affect its health or value on the market. Computer vision algorithms can analyze images taken by UAVs mounted with cameras to identify animals and determine their characteristics using image recognition techniques. This data is then transmitted back to a central base station where it is stored in a database for future use by farmers or veterinarians who need this information for monitoring or treatment purposes.